What is Miss Evers' Boys about?

The true story of the US Government's 1932 Tuskeegee Syphilis Experiments, in which a group of black test subjects were allowed to die, despite a cure having been developed.

Miss Evers' Boys is an American made-for-television drama starring Alfre Woodard and Laurence Fishburne that first aired on February 22, 1997, and is based on the true story of the four-decade-long Tuskegee Syphilis Study. The main character Nurse Eunice Evers is based on Eunice Rivers Laurie. It was directed by Joseph Sargent and adapted by Walter Bernstein from the 1992 stage play of the same name, written by David Feldshuh. It received twelve nominations at the 1997 Primetime Emmy Awards, ultimately winning five, including Outstanding Television Movie and the President's Award.

What does the cinematography of Miss Evers' Boys look like?

Sampled across 51 frames, the coverage of Miss Evers' Boys leans heavily on medium shots (76% of the sample). Cinematographer Donald M. Morgan keeps 47% of it in soft, naturalistic light. Vintage glass shapes the frame. Focus stays shallow in 88% of the frames, isolating subjects from their surroundings.
